Output 3020150686da12b88e636f14d5a8d72da902d6ecf69d2cee50cdd6d240583ae6:0

value
6451297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ecd0837cd7ad82a852b607cb7a7e248328051ab OP_EQUAL
address
38sgFPP4ScbCuSHRDtVJ3KbznpbwW3ws7d
transaction
3020150686da12b88e636f14d5a8d72da902d6ecf69d2cee50cdd6d240583ae6